Default Which fuel pressure gauge do you use?

I'm referring to the under-the-hood type, not the remote gauges that you mount on your dash. Anything in particular I should look for when buying? I'm having issues w/ my 200K mile Accord and I'd like to get some before & after readings on the fuel pressure when I replace the fuel filter.
